Cinnamomum verum J. Presl.
Daruchini (- Mahastanbazar village Bogra)
| name | Cinnamomum verum J. Presl. |
| Local Name | Daruchini |
| Tribe (Info) | - |
| Village | Mahastanbazar village |
| District ( Map) | Bogra |
| Part(s) Used | Barks and roots |
| Ailment | Tonic, hypocholesterolemic, cardiac disorders |
| Procurement | Mahastanbazar village, Bogra |
| The information is collected by Prof. Rahmatullah, University of Development Alternative, Bangladesh. | |
Cinnamomum tamala Nees et Eberm.
Tejpata (- - -)
| name | Cinnamomum tamala Nees et Eberm. |
| Local Name | Tejpata |
| Tribe (Info) | - |
| Village | - |
| District ( Map) | - |
| Part(s) Used | - |
| Ailment | Juice from the leaves are taken as stimulant; also used for itches. |
| Procurement | |
| The information is collected by Prof. Rahmatullah, University of Development Alternative, Bangladesh. | |
Cinnamomum obtusifolium (Roxb.) Nees.
Gau-aure (Chak - -)
| name | Cinnamomum obtusifolium (Roxb.) Nees. |
| Local Name | Gau-aure |
| Tribe (Info) | Chak |
| Village | - |
| District ( Map) | - |
| Part(s) Used | Root |
| Ailment | Acidity, bloating, stomach ache. A pinch of powdered root is sucked for 3-5 times. |
| Procurement | |
| The information is collected by Prof. Rahmatullah, University of Development Alternative, Bangladesh. | |
Stomasingh (Murong - -)
| name | Cinnamomum obtusifolium (Roxb.) Nees. |
| Local Name | Stomasingh |
| Tribe (Info) | Murong |
| Village | - |
| District ( Map) | - |
| Part(s) Used | Root |
| Ailment | Head ache, sedative. Juice from the roots is massaged on the head. |
| Procurement | |
| The information is collected by Prof. Rahmatullah, University of Development Alternative, Bangladesh. | |
Mimigru, tojbol, gau-aure (Tripura - -)
| name | Cinnamomum obtusifolium (Roxb.) Nees. |
| Local Name | Mimigru, tojbol, gau-aure |
| Tribe (Info) | Tripura |
| Village | - |
| District ( Map) | - |
| Part(s) Used | Root |
| Ailment | Headache, dizziness. 1. Root paste is applied to the forehead. |
| Procurement | |
| The information is collected by Prof. Rahmatullah, University of Development Alternative, Bangladesh. | |
